A devastating final text message from two men who died in an horrific plane crash in Westchester County on their way to a funeral has emerged - their final text to friends saying they'd 'lost engines.'Boruch Taub and Binyamin 'Ben' Chafetz, both from Cleveland and identified by Jewish news organization, , tragically died on Thursday night when they encountered issues in their single engine aircraft at about 5.25pm. Taub, owner of 'MasterWorks Automotive & Transmission,' had been the pilot of the Beechcraft Bonanza A36, while, Chafetz, who worked as a tech entrepreneur, had been his only passenger.
